Breaking Dawn by Stephenie Meyer has been elevated to the status of books that are hyped and qualify for release events like those for Harry Potter. All over the country next Friday night, fans will gather in book stores dressed as their favorite characters and wait for midnight when the book goes on sale. Last February Knopf Books moved the release date of Christopher Paolini's Brisingr, the third in the Inheritance series to Friday, September 20th.
This type of marketing is great for publishers, but booksellers are not as happy. The publishers, after all, don't pick up the cost of the release events and don't care if the release date conflicts with other events or summer staffing problems. If release events are more frequent, could the excitement on an individual titles dwindle to "mah, that again?" Nonetheless, fans of these two books want the book immediately.
